Transaction 339fa2af18e2bc56b75b490602a40e744ac13e54f89186c95fd45436295a7572
1 Input
1 Output
-
339fa2af18e2bc56b75b490602a40e744ac13e54f89186c95fd45436295a7572:0
- value
- 5612
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 caab626b59fcf94c672af0d44ccfb76fb7487f9422a473888598aacb2d23bc9a
- address
- bc1pe24ky66elnu5cee27r2yenahd7m5slu5y2j88zy9nz4vktfrhjdqcdgzhk